We briefly review the current status of standard oscillations of atmospheric neutrinos in schemes with two, three, and four flavor mixing. It is shown that, although the pure νμ-->ντchannel provides an excellent 2νfit to the data, one cannot exclude, at present, the occurrence of additional subleading νμ-->νe oscillations (3νschemes) or of sizable νμ-->νs oscillations (4νschemes). It is also shown that the wide dynamical range of energy and pathlength probed by the Super-Kamiokande experiment puts severe constraints on nonstandard explanations of the atmospheric neutrino data, with a few notable exceptions.
